1.4 Description of processing routes Lithium is widely distributed in trace amounts in rocks, salts and natural waters, as shown in the figure below. However, most of the commercial reserves are contained in continental brines (salt flats) and hard rock minerals (generally in the form of spodumene).
Brines, such as continental brines (salars) are mainly found in Argentina, Chile, while geothermal and oilfield brines are located in the US. Brines can be used to produce lithium carbonate, lithium hydroxide and lithium chloride.
Hard rock mineral deposits are mainly found in Australia, the US, China and also in Africa. They mainly produce mineral concentrates for direct technical market sales or conversion into other lithium chemicals, mainly in China.
